Exploring the Future of Web3 with .Art: A Deep Dive into Domains and the Transition from Web 2 to Web 3

Unravel the mystery of the world of Web3 as we go behind the scenes with our special guest, Ivan Kraft and get a unique insight into his work with .ART, a domain that is bridging the gap between Web 2 and Web 3. Mr. Kraft shares how artists can now create their unique brands with a single name, creating a seamless blend of wallet, website, and email.
The transition from Web 2 to Web 3 is no small feat, and we dive head-first into the legal hurdles and value addition that .art brings to the blockchain. As we venture deeper, watch the world of domain verification and NFT management unfold, delve into smart contracts' flexibility, and the role of DAO in domain representation. The conversation gets intense as we talk about domain ownership, the role of UDRP in brand protection, and how binders safeguard users in the vast domain industry.
Finally, we explore the power of domain signaling, how it signifies a person's involvement in the web 3 space, and its role in ensuring artists get their due. The conversation gets even more exciting as we discuss domains as NFTs, the creation of twin domain names, and the implications of domain transfer to NFTs. Tune in and fuel your curiosity as we explore buying and selling domain names, the success rate of fractional token systems, and how it can bridge the gap between Web 2 and Web 3. This episode promises to be a fabulous journey into the future of Web3 and beyond.
